Transaction f51b234c21291a581eb71727c73f1c168488ccad214142cc732a3239c787dbe5

1 Input
2 Outputs
  • f51b234c21291a581eb71727c73f1c168488ccad214142cc732a3239c787dbe5:0
  • value  125681
    address  33irCMS7kqqoY1CkMmiV258DS7Sc1Mdd5C
  • f51b234c21291a581eb71727c73f1c168488ccad214142cc732a3239c787dbe5:1
  • value  19868416
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o